The Ultimate Guide to Discovering a Realtor in Tucson for Your Dream Home
Tucson, Arizona, is a captivating blend of natural beauty, vibrant culture, and a thriving real estate market. Nestled in the heart of the Sonoran Desert, the city provides a unique charm that pulls homebuyers from all walks of life. In case you’re planning to buy your dream dwelling in Tucson, discovering the appropriate realtor is your first and most important step. A skilled realtor can make the home-buying process seamless and make sure you get the perfect deal. Here’s your final guide to finding a realtor in Tucson who will enable you to secure your dream home.
1. Understand Your Wants
Earlier than diving into your seek for a realtor, take a while to assess your particular needs. Are you looking for a comfortable downtown loft, a sprawling desert ranch, or a family-friendly residence in a quiet neighborhood? Understanding your priorities will help you establish a realtor with expertise in the type of property and area you’re interested in.
Additionally, set up your budget and timeline. Realtors can higher help you if they understand your financial constraints and urgency. Knowing your non-negotiables, corresponding to proximity to schools, public transport, or scenic views, will further narrow down your choices.
2. Research Local Realtors
The key to discovering a superb realtor in Tucson is thorough research. Start by asking for recommendations from friends, family, or colleagues who've just lately bought property within the area. Personal referrals often lead to trusted professionals with a proven track record.
Subsequent, look online. Websites like Zillow, Realtor.com, and Yelp provide directories of realtors with evaluations and ratings. Pay attention to the feedback from previous clients, focusing on their experiences with communication, negotiation, and general satisfaction. Social media platforms and local real estate boards will also be valuable resources.
3. Look for Local Experience
Tucson has a various real estate market, and every neighborhood has its own unique features. A realtor with in-depth knowledge of the local market is essential. As an example, a professional acquainted with the luxurious homes in Catalina Foothills won't be the perfect fit for someone seeking a starter residence in the University area.
Ask prospective realtors about their experience in specific neighborhoods and types of properties. A local knowledgeable will have insights into market trends, pricing, and upcoming developments, which can significantly influence your buying decision.
4. Verify Credentials and Experience
Upon getting a brieflist of potential realtors, verify their credentials. Ensure they're licensed in Arizona by checking the Arizona Department of Real Estate’s website. Look for certifications corresponding to Certified Residential Specialist (CRS) or Accredited Buyer’s Representative (ABR), which indicate specialised training and expertise.
Expertise issues, too. A seasoned realtor will have a network of contacts, together with mortgage brokers, dwelling inspectors, and contractors, which can streamline the process of shopping for a home. Don’t hesitate to ask what number of transactions they’ve handled in Tucson and the typical time it takes them to close deals.
5. Schedule Interviews
Meeting potential realtors in individual or by way of video call is a superb way to gauge their compatibility. Prepare a list of inquiries to ask through the interview, such as:
How long have you ever been working in Tucson’s real estate market?
What strategies do you utilize to search out the perfect properties for shoppers?
Are you able to provide references from recent buyers you’ve worked with?
Pay attention to how they communicate. Are they attentive, responsive, and genuinely interested in your wants? A superb realtor will listen careabsolutely and provide thoughtful advice tailored to your situation.
6. Consider Their Availability
Real estate transactions will be time-sensitive, so your realtor’s availability is crucial. Discover out in the event that they work full-time or part-time and whether they have a team to help with tasks. A full-time realtor with a dedicated assist system will likely be more responsive and efficient.
7. Trust Your Instincts
While credentials and expertise are essential, trust your instincts when selecting a realtor. This particular person will guide you through one of the significant financial selections of your life, so it’s essential to really feel comfortable and confident in their abilities.
8. Leverage Technology
Many top realtors in Tucson use advanced tools to assist buyers find their dream homes. Look for professionals who make the most of technology, resembling virtual excursions, digital contracts, and online market analysis, to enhance your experience.
9. Ask About Their Negotiation Skills
Negotiation is a critical part of the house-shopping for process. Your realtor should have sturdy negotiation skills to ensure you get the very best worth to your money. Focus on their approach to handling gives, counteroffers, and closing deals.
10. Overview the Contract
When you’ve chosen a realtor, review the agreement careabsolutely earlier than signing. Guarantee it outlines their responsibilities, commission construction, and the period of the contract. Don’t hesitate to ask for clarifications on any terms you don’t understand.
Conclusion
Finding the right realtor in Tucson is a vital step toward securing your dream home. By understanding your needs, conducting thorough research, and choosing a professional with local experience, you’ll set yourself up for a successful dwelling-buying journey. Remember, the proper realtor will not only guide you through the process but additionally make it an enjoyable and rewarding experience. Your dream home in Tucson is just just a few steps away!
